My 3 Top Tips for Wedding Skincare Prep

By Professional Makeup Artist and Beauty Blogger Bonnie Ryan

1. Prepare in Advance!
If regular facials are something you are planning to incorporate into your pre-wedding skin-care routine, you should start working alongside your skin therapist 6-12 months before your big day. Texture and pigmentation are two of the main things people want to fix before a wedding and can take a while to correct, so this being said it’s best to start as soon as possible working on it. Everyone’s skin is different, needs different care and each person will have different concerns so I think it’s wise to set up a consultation at first so you and your skin specialist are on the same page as to what your end goal for your wedding is. I would also recommend to book a bridal makeup trial early, as it’s important to be comfortable with how your makeup looks and ensure the products used suit you, too.

2. Manage Stress Levels
It’s not just all about looking after the outside when it comes to skin. Planning and the direct lead up to a wedding can be stressful. It has been proven that stress can have a direct impact on your skin health, certain pro-inflammatory glands and certain cells can become triggered when your body is in stress and can lead to many different skin concerns and breakouts. I really believe it’s so important to incorporate things into your day in the lead up to your wedding to keep stress levels down, such as:

  • Exercising: it can help release endorphins, which have a calming effect on the body and mind
  •  Yoga: it will help focuses on breathing and relaxation, which can help calm the nervous system and keep your body out of that “fight or flight” mode 
  • Meditation: being one of my favourite ways to relax. Even 5 minutes each day has a proven effect to help calm the central nervous system

3. Look at Your Diet
Ideally, you should be eating a balanced diet with a wide range of nutrients. This isn’t always easy when you’re busy (and stressed!).
